With respect to the marketing mix for Slamix, the product manager must consider product, price, place, and promotion strategies. A product is defined as anything offered for sale or exchange to another person including physical objects, services, places, organizations, and ideas. Consumers typically recognize five distinctive product characteristicsùquality level, features, styling, brand name, and packaging. Depending upon the type of product involvedùphysical, service, and so forth, not all of these characteristics will be applicable in each instance. Quality level, features, brand name, and packaging are important factors for the product manager to consider in the development of a marketing mix for Slamix.
